AWS BVPd-1 vs. EN 2.4878 Nickel

AWS BVPd-1 belongs to the otherwise unclassified metals classification, while EN 2.4878 nickel belongs to the nickel alloys. They have a modest 20% of their average alloy composition in common, which, by itself, doesn't mean much. There are 15 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(14,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is AWS BVPd-1 and the bottom bar is EN 2.4878 nickel.
